Explore the Ernst Moritz Arndt Tower for breathtaking views and a touch of history in Bergen auf Rügen, the heart of Germany's beautiful island.
The Ernst Moritz Arndt Tower in Bergen auf Rügen is a stunning historical landmark that offers breathtaking panoramic views of the surrounding landscapes. Built to honor the 19th-century poet Ernst Moritz Arndt, this tower is a must-visit for history enthusiasts and nature lovers alike. Climb the spiral staircase to reach the viewing platform and enjoy the idyllic scenery of Rügen Island, making it a perfect spot for unforgettable photographs.

Car
If you are traveling by car, make your way to Bergen auf Rügen, which is centrally located on Rügen Island. From there, head towards the B196 road. Follow B196 in the direction of Bergen until you see signs for Ernst Moritz Arndt Tower. The tower is located approximately 3 kilometers from the center of Bergen. There is a small parking area near the base of the tower where you can park your vehicle free of charge.
Public Transportation
For those using public transportation, take a bus from any major town on Rügen Island to Bergen auf Rügen. Once in Bergen, you will need to catch Bus 19, which goes towards the Ernst Moritz Arndt Tower. Get off the bus at the stop closest to the tower (look for signs indicating 'Ernst Moritz Arndt Tower'). The bus fare varies but is generally around €2-€3. Expect a short walk (about 10 minutes) from the bus stop to the tower.
Walking
If you are already in Bergen, you can also walk to the Ernst Moritz Arndt Tower. The walk is approximately 30 minutes and is a pleasant route that takes you through some scenic areas. Head northeast from the town center, following signs towards the tower. The path is well marked, and you will enjoy the natural beauty of Rügen Island along the way.
